Tidmore Bend is a community in Etowah County, Alabama, home to 1,086 residents. Its median household income of $49,688 runs below the Etowah County figure of $53,070.

Between 2019 and 2023, Tidmore Bend's population declined 11.1% from 1,221 to 1,086, while its median home value rose 103.4% from $90,800 to $184,700.

86.1% of workers drive to work alone. 84.5% of homes are single-family detached houses.
